Handsontable is free and open source. @FullyWashable, @DCGenomics, as noted in yesterday's demo, this application currently uses the DataTables library (http://www.datatables.net/, https://github.com/DataTables/DataTables). By default it supports reading, but not editing. Editing DataTables is possible with a paid plug-in, https://editor.datatables.net/. Handsontable offers such table editing functionality out-of-the-box for free. Editing is an essential but currently unimplemented feature of our application. Given that, I will see what I can do over the next few days to prototype a new Metadata Categorization user interface with Handsontable. |
